There are a wide array of smart ring doorbells available in the market today and all coming with detailed installation instructions. Here, we’ll make it clearer to enable you get it done right, the right time and with little stress. With a properly installed ring video doorbell, you’ll be able to identify who’s at the door before opening and even chat with them via your table, PC or Smartphone. And to make it even more interesting, you can easily install a ring doorbell yourself and save some money.
Installation Steps
• Assemble the mounting bracket
Bring out the mounting bracket that comes with your ring video doorbell. You’ll discover a small level within the mounting bracket, put this on the bracket’s slot. Once done, gently line it up to the spot where you want to place your doorbell.
• Determine the pilot holes
Firstly, ensure the bubble found in the level is straight. Then, mark out where the screws will go through.
• Drill the identified pilot hole spots
When drilling, you’ll need not just your drill and drill bit (or a masonry bit, if its a brick), but also your eye and ear protection. Drill the marked out spots to create pilot holes and subsequently hammer in the plastic anchors that comes in the ring doorbell’s pack to help hold your screws in place. Once done, put the bracket on the top and tighten your screws.
• Scan the QR Code
With the use of your phone, scan the special QR code given behind your doorbell to ensure the ring doorbell is only accessible by you and your loved ones.
• Secure the doorbell
Ensure that the bracket is properly in place and attach your doorbell to the mounting bracket. Once done, you can make it safe by using smaller security screws to hold it. Upon completion, your ring doorbell is ready for use - it’s that easy!

According to several studies and survey of ex-burglars, a home or building is less likely to be burgled with the availability of properly functioning and well fitted burglar alarm system. So if you’re thinking about installing one in your house, you can as well make sure you get the best possible burglar alarm that’s just right for your home. Several people asks the question of the best burglar alarm, but the fact is, it all depends on a number of factors such as your budget, personal preferences, your location, home features as well as the protection and response level you require. To put you in the right direction to make the best choice, here’s a breakdown of the types of burglar alarm systems to help you determine the one that will best suit your home.
lBells-Only Alarms
This makes a loud sound but that’s as far as it goes. It will not contact anyone.
Pros
• No monitoring contract and payment
• Easy to install
Cons
• It does not contact anyone.
• It may not deter the burglars if there’s no one around to stop the intrusion.
lDialler Burglar Alarms
This contacts your phone or any other numbers nominated once the alarm is triggered.
Pros
• No monitoring contract and payment.
• Nominated numbers would be dialled
• It can also notify you of other dangers such as fire if extra sensors are acquired.
Cons
• If you opt for a GSM dialler, a weak mobile network can affect its effectiveness
• Nominated numbers may be unavailable when dialled.
lSmart home security system
This contacts your or your loved ones whenever the alarm is triggered via a Smartphone or tablet application.
Pros
• Notifies you when away from home
• Can be monitored and controlled from a Smartphone
Cons
• If you opt for a GSM dialler, a weak mobile network can affect its effectiveness
• They can be expensive depending on your selected elements
lA monitoring contract
This implies paying a monthly or annual fee to a company to act or notify the police the your alarm is triggered
Pros
• The monitoring company is in hand to act in order to prevent the potential burglary and liable if it doesn’t.
• Some of the companies also offer maintenance services
Cons
• Expensive
• It cannot be installed by yourself
